Is It Normal For My Furnace Filter to Be Black So Fast?

Furnace filters should be inspected monthly and changed at least every one to three months to keep your indoor air clean and protect your heating system. You can check your filter by removing it from the furnace and holding it up to an overhead light. If light can pass through the filter, so can air. … [Read More]

How Lighting Can Change The Ambience Of Your Home

Layering lighting is essential for creating depth and dimension in your home’s ambiance. Start by combining different types of lighting sources, such as overhead fixtures, task lights and accent lighting.
